How Much Weight Can an MDF Shelf Hold? An MDF shelf can hold 10 lbs to 30 lbs on average (4.54-13.61 kg) and 79 lbs (35.83 kg) in larger non-floating varieties. The capacity of the shelf depends on its span, depth, anchoring mechanism, and the material it is fixed to. The number, thickness, and density of the wood layers that make up plywood affect how … NettetA standard shelf measurement of 3-foot by-1-inch-by-12-inch should bear the following weights: 313 pounds for oak shelving, 200 pounds for pine, 129 pounds for plywood, and 87 pounds for MDF, This Old House advises. Normal sagging is 1/4 inch, which increases by another 1/8 inch over time. Video of the Day.
